For most healthy adults,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) suggests a safe daily caffeine limit of 400 mg, roughly equivalent to four 8-ounce cups of coffee. This makes the question 'Is 7 coffees a day bad for you?' a critical one, as this level of consumption can significantly exceed recommended limits and lead to unwanted health consequences.
